UC00004 - Movimentação de series

De Wiki Java - Interno
(Diferença entre revisões)
Ir para: navegação, pesquisa
(Regras de negócio)
(RN01 - Campo para informar a chave da NFe)
Linha 33: Linha 33:
  
 
= Regras de negócio =
 
= Regras de negócio =
== RN01 - Campo para informar a chave da NFe ==
+
== RN01 - Regras e funcionalidades da tela "Séries" ==
 +
Na tela '''Séries''' os campos '''Produto''', '''Unidade de compra''', '''Quantidade''' e '''Valor total''' ficarão sempre desabilitados e serão automaticamente preenchidos com os
 +
dados já informados na tela antecessora. Estas informações serão apenas paraleitura.
 +
 
 +
 +
 
 +
Logo abaixo docabeçalho há um campo onde o usuário deverá informar a quantidade de sériesequivalente a quantidade do item exibida no cabeçalho.
 +
 
 +
 +
 
 +
Deverá serinformado um número de série por linha. Todos os dados contidos em umadeterminada linha serão considerados como uma única série.
 +
 
 +
 +
 
 +
Espaços em brancoantes e/ou depois dos números de série serão automaticamente desconsiderados.
 +
 
 +
 +
 
 +
Quando usuárioacionar o botão <OK> o sistema verificará:
 +
 
 +
·        Se a quantidade de linhas/séries informadascorrespondem à quantidade informada no cabeçalho da tela de relação de séries.Se as quantidades forem diferentes uma mensagem com a não conformidade seráexibida ao usuário.
 +
 
 +
 +
 
 +
·        Se as séries informadas já existem no estoque para omesmo ou para os demais produtos já cadastrados. Se a série já existe noestoque uma mensagem com a não conformidade será exibida ao usuário.
 +
 
 +
 +
Se as quantidades foremcoerentes e se as séries forem inéditas, as séries ficarão gravadas em memóriae serão movimentadas junto com a movimentação de estoque da tela antecessora.

Edição das 15h28min de 14 de março de 2014

Conteúdo

Objetivo

  • Definir regras e funcionalidades para movimentação de itens que controlam série.

Atores

  • Usuário

Pré-requisitos

  • Seguir orientações do documento de padrões de desenvolvimento.
  • Ter cadastrados produtos que controlam série.
  • Estar movimentando produtos que controlam série.


Resultado esperado

  • Movimentar estoque de produtos que controlam série.

Diagrama de classes

Series.png

Layouts sugeridos

Fluxo de eventos

Fluxos principais

Fluxo 1:

Fluxos alternativos

Fluxos de exceções

Fluxo 1:

Regras de negócio

RN01 - Regras e funcionalidades da tela "Séries"

Na tela Séries os campos Produto, Unidade de compra, Quantidade e Valor total ficarão sempre desabilitados e serão automaticamente preenchidos com os dados já informados na tela antecessora. Estas informações serão apenas paraleitura.


Logo abaixo docabeçalho há um campo onde o usuário deverá informar a quantidade de sériesequivalente a quantidade do item exibida no cabeçalho.


Deverá serinformado um número de série por linha. Todos os dados contidos em umadeterminada linha serão considerados como uma única série.


Espaços em brancoantes e/ou depois dos números de série serão automaticamente desconsiderados.


Quando usuárioacionar o botão <OK> o sistema verificará:

· Se a quantidade de linhas/séries informadascorrespondem à quantidade informada no cabeçalho da tela de relação de séries.Se as quantidades forem diferentes uma mensagem com a não conformidade seráexibida ao usuário.


· Se as séries informadas já existem no estoque para omesmo ou para os demais produtos já cadastrados. Se a série já existe noestoque uma mensagem com a não conformidade será exibida ao usuário.


Se as quantidades foremcoerentes e se as séries forem inéditas, as séries ficarão gravadas em memóriae serão movimentadas junto com a movimentação de estoque da tela antecessora.

Ferramentas pessoais
Espaços nominais

Variantes
Visualizações
Ações
Navegação
Ferramentas